Q: Would you give some examples of abnormal use or strain, neglect
or abuse which may affect warranty?
A: These terms are general and overlap each other in areas. Some
specific examples may include: running the snowmobile out
of oil, chain failure caused by a Iack of lubrication, operating
the snowmobile with a broken or damaged part which causes
another part to fail, and so on. If you have any specific questions
on operation or maintenance, please contact an authorized
SKI-DOO dealer for advice.
Q: What costs are my responsibility during the warranty period?
A: The customer's responsibility includes all costs of normal main-
tenance services, non-warranty repairs, accidents and collision
damage, as well as oils, and spark plugs, and incidental or con-
sequential damages costs as explained in the warranty.
Q: Are " Genuine" Bombardier replacement parts used in warranty
repairs covered by warranty?
A: Yes. When installed by an authorized SKI-DOO dealer, any
"Genuine" Bombardier part used in warranty repairs assumes
the remaining warranty that exists on the snowmobile.
Q: If I sell my snowmobile within the warranty period, will the new
owner qualify for the balance of the warranty?
A: Yes, provided the resale has been registered with the manu-
facturer.
Q: How can I receive the best owner assistance?
A: The satisfaction and goodwill of the owners of Bombardier
products are of primary concern to your authorized SKI-DOO
dealer and Bombardier. Normally, any problems that arise in
connection with the sales transaction or the operation of your
snowmobile will be handled by your authorized SKI-DOO Deal-
ers Sales or Service Departments. It is recognized, however,
that despite the best intentions of everyone concerned, mis-
understandings will sometimes occur. Frequently, complaints
are the result of a breakdown in communications and can
quickly be resolved by a member of the authorized SKI-DOO
dealership management. If the problem already has been re-
viewed with the Sales Manager or Service Manager, contact
the General Manager or the owner of this authorized SKI-DOO
dealership.
